UPDATE: According to a representative who spoke with Pitchfork, Rihanna is not going to appear in Annette. They say that the original report from Variety is inaccurate.

People love musicals. People love Adam Driver. People really love Rihanna. Put all three together and you have a recipe for a real winner. That’s exactly what Amazon Studios is hoping for anyway. According to Variety, the online retailer/movie studio has recently acquired the distribution rights to a new film titled Annette, allegedly starring both the Star Wars villain and the Anti singer.

Directed by French filmmaker Leos Carax, in what will be his first English-language feature, the musical is also said to feature music by the 1970s glam rock group Sparks.
